External Progression Scholarship
Available to international students who successfully progress from an INTO programme or other pathways onto one of our undergraduate or postgraduate taught courses.
Key facts
As part of our commitment to attracting the very best students to join our diverse international community, we are delighted to offer the External Progression Scholarships.
This scholarship is available to students who successfully progress from a qualifying pathway programme delivered by any relevant pathway programme at any INTO centre or any other recognised pathway provider in the UK onto a University of Stirling undergraduate or postgraduate taught courses.
Students who progress with an overall score of 70% and above - £4,000 fee waiver
Students who progress with an overall score of 60% to 69% - £3,000 fee waiver
Students who progress with an overall score of 50% to 59% - £2,000 fee waiver
The fee waiver only applies to the first year of study at the University of Stirling.
Eligibility and availability
- You must have received a conditional or unconditional offer of admissions for an eligible undergraduate or postgraduate taught course at the University of Stirling.
- You must be classed as overseas for tuition fee purposes.
- You must have successfully completed a relevant pathway programme at any INTO centre or relevant pathway programme at any INTO centre or any other recognised pathway provider in the UK.
- You must be a full-time student.
- This scholarship is only available to students studying at our Stirling campus.
Please note that award of this scholarship cannot be combined with any other University of Stirling scholarship or award.
